kłócić się — meaning in English

Polish → English · translate English → Polish instead

English meaning

  • wrangle verb To argue or quarrel at length, often noisily.

Senses

kłócić się is used for these senses in English:

  • butt heads (idiomatic) To argue uncompromisingly.
  • cross swords (idiomatic) To quarrel or argue with someone; to have a dispute with someone.
  • wrangle (also, figuratively) To quarrel angrily and noisily; to bicker.

wrangle — full definition

  1. verb To argue or quarrel at length, often noisily.
  2. verb To herd or manage animals, or by extension, people or data.
  3. noun A long, noisy argument.
